I've been in the place you are in and if we're being completely honest, I feel like I am going through this phase all over again. The feeling that you're life is crumbling all around you and you can't find a way to get a firm grip on it and be in control once again. It's a horrible feeling, but just remember that feeling won't last forever.

I know, it's hard to accept the fact that you'll be able to get through whatever obstacle is in the way of your happiness and it may have gotten to the point where you feel hopeless and just want to give up on everything you have been working so hard towards. Nothing in this life is easy, and I think that as we grow up and mature more and more, this idea that life isn't easy is always thrown in our face in forms of different challenges and obstacles you have to overcome on a daily basis. You might think to yourself, "what is the point of working so hard if all of this bad comes with it?" Well, you have to remember that with the bad also comes the good. Your life will not continue to be in this hopeless state if you put all your energy and focus on to make sure you're on the right path.

Yes it is true, life will throw off your plans and maybe take you on a different path than you expected to take, but you are still in control of your own life and you have all of the power. You are either going to let the bad throw off everything you have worked so hard for or you're going to take all of the hardships and obstacles you have encountered to better yourself and make yourself stronger.

The key to making this all work is to surround yourself with a good support system. I tend to just isolate myself when I am feeling hopeless and it only makes the problem worse. You need to confide in certain people that you trust and let them know what is going on with you. If they truly care, they will listen and help you get through whatever it is you are currently going through. If talking about what you're feeling on an emotional level isn't your cup of tea, engulf yourself in things that make you happy. For me, writing makes me happy and is my escape. Putting my emotions onto paper so that I can read it back to myself is this great release. I am addressing how I am feeling about myself and it is this huge weight that is lifted off of my shoulders. Whatever it is that makes you your happiest, do it. Don't sit in your room and dwell on all of the bad, trust me it will only make things worse for you.

Everyone goes through these phases in life of hopelessness. It is nothing to be ashamed of, but it is your responsibility to make sure that you take care of yourself when you are dealing with such heavy emotions. No one but you knows what you are dealing with, so make sure that you make yourself a priority during these dark times. This time will pass, I can promise you that. Life is so much more than just the bad, never forget that.
